Seeking talent in the field of Information Security

DNO - On September 21st, the final round of the Cybersecurity Talent Search Competition - Digital Dragons: The Cybersecurity Challenge (DDC 2025) took place at the Vietnam-Korea University of Information Technology and Communication (VKU), University of Da Nang.

The competition is organized by the Vietnam-Korea University of Information and Communication Technology in collaboration with EvvoLab, Singapore, under the professional patronage of the National Cyber ​​Security Association (NCA).

Digital Dragons: The Cybersecurity Challenge is a competition for university students nationwide who are passionate about information technology and information security.

DDC 2025 attracted 146 teams with 573 contestants from many prestigious universities such as Hanoi University of Science and Technology, Cryptography Technical Academy, University of Technology (Vietnam National University, Hanoi), Ho Chi Minh City University of Information Technology (Vietnam National University, Ho Chi Minh City), Ho Chi Minh City University of Technology,FPT University, Duy Tan University, VKU…

Following the preliminary round, 25 outstanding teams from 16 universities advanced to the final round and competed directly.

In the final round, the competing teams conquered a variety of challenges, from web application penetration, network analysis, advanced cryptography, binary mining, reverse engineering techniques to realistic cybersecurity scenarios…

In the end, the CyberCh1ck team from the Academy of Cryptography Engineering ( Hanoi ) excellently won first prize; the UIT.The Lost Beyond team from the University of Information Technology (Vietnam National University Ho Chi Minh City) won second prize; and the Ruby Chan team from the Academy of Cryptography Engineering's branch in Ho Chi Minh City won third prize.

In addition, the Organizing Committee awarded 5 Encouragement prizes, numerous promising awards and supplementary prizes; the Most Popular Video Media award went to the VSL.0utl4w (VKU) team. The total prize value of DDC 2025 is nearly 40 million VND.

Dr. Tran The Son, Vice Rector of the Vietnam-Korea University of Information and Communication Technology, believes that the competition is not only an opportunity for students to showcase their talents and creativity, but also an important step in raising awareness and knowledge about information security in the community.

The competition is an opportunity for students to learn more about the field of information security; it helps students hone their skills, expand their knowledge, and discover groundbreaking solutions in protecting information security.

As part of DDC 2025, a Cybersecurity Workshop was held, providing many valuable academic experiences for students and the technology community.
